The provincial government of Aurora announced class suspension for Monday, Sept. 26, due to Typhoon “Karding.”
According to the latest weather forecast of Philippine Atmospheric, Geophysical, and Astronomical Services Administration (PAGASA), “Karding” is moving 285 kilometers east of Infanta, Quezon and will likely be a super typhoon.
Typhoon “Karding” will make landfall in the northern portion of Quezon or the southern portion of Aurora on Sunday night, Sept. 25.
Tropical Cyclone Wind Signal No. 2 is currently raised in the province of Aurora.
